インストール

PyPI からライブラリをインストールする場合でも、GitHub からクローンを作成する場合でも、 次の手順は、仮想マシン(VM)インスタンス VM に できます。仮想マシンを作成して有効にする方法については、 仮想環境のドキュメントをご覧ください。

PyPI からモジュールをインストールする

このライブラリは PyPI で配布されており、 pip を使用して、 次のコマンドを実行します。

python -m pip install google-ads

GitHub からライブラリをインストールする

ライブラリのソースコードは GitHub からクローンを作成できます。 インストールします。ソースコードのクローンを作成すると、ソースコードの サンプルの実行やライブラリ自体の開発を行えます。参考までに、 認証例の 1 つは、ライブラリを構成する際の 使用できます。

  1. python3.8 以降が環境に存在することを確認します。 最も簡単な方法は、pyenv を使用することです。

    pyenv local 3.8
    
  2. GitHub からクライアント ライブラリのクローンを作成します。

    git clone git@github.com:googleads/google-ads-python.git
    
  3. リポジトリを入力してインストールします。

    cd google-ads-python
    python -m pip install .
    
  4. ライブラリを開発する場合は、前後に単体テストを実施してください。 次のように変更します。

    1. サポートされているすべてのバージョンの Python 言語が できます。pyenv を使用する場合:

      pyenv local 3.8 3.9 3.10 3.11 3.12
      
    2. ライブラリのテスト固有の依存関係をインストールします。

      python -m pip install .[tests]
      
    3. 単体テストを実行して、ライブラリが正しく動作していることを確認します。

      nox
      
    4. (省略可)Docker を使用して単体テストを実行することもできます。まず、 Docker がインストールされている。次に、 google-ads-python ディレクトリで次のコマンドを実行します。

      docker build -t google-ads-python:test .
      docker run -it google-ads-python:test nox